I can not seem to figure out how to implement new items like cane of byrna. I have messed with the subscreens but can not seem to figure out how to allow for new or more items. I can make the box bigger where the items go and made a new square for it to fit in. The option to select an item class under attributes is not available like it i s for the existing items. Is there some kind of subscreen tutorial around? I am using Bs graphics on build 254. Also there is a lot of trash icons on my subscreen that I would like to clean up. How do you select what subscreen it will use. There are the passive and active subscreen but how do I use a replacement subscreen I made? Thanks for help in advance.

You make a new item slot by going to New->Current Item and under attributes set the itme you want it to be. But for you to be able to select it you have to mess with the numbers in attributes. Basicly the position box is that items number, and the boxes below it are what item it jumps to when you press the appropriate button. So for example, item three should have 2 to the left of it and 4 to the right if they're in a row. Oh, and make sure you have "Invisible" unchecked.
I'm explaining all this just in case. Now, you can't set custom items in the subscreen yet, so you have to apply them to a current item and use it that way, if it makes sense. As for junk icons, just select them and hit "Del"

Thanks for your response. It helped me fix some of my problems. Are you saying that you can replace an existing item with another but can not add more items in total. Basically I can not have another row of items in my subscreen.

No, you can add new items, but you can't put in items you've scripted(Well, you can but you have to overwrite somthing else)(I think L fixed this today, or somthing). It can only be items that already exist in ZC.
